Jayne MalenfantÌýis a doctoral student in the Faculty of Education and she has earned two of Canada’s most prestigious awards for graduate students – a Trudeau Foundation Doctoral Scholarship and a Vanier Canada Graduate Scholarship. That all might come as a surprise to some of the people who knew her in high school – especially if they remember that Malenfant was expelled from the school.

The Mohawk community of Kahnawà:ke and McGill launched the first-ever Bachelor of Education (B. Ed.)ÌýFirst Nations and Inuit Education (FNIE)ÌýÌýprogram to be given in the community of Kahnawà:ke, on August 20.

It’s a labour of love between McGill’s Office of First Nations and Inuit Education (OFNIE) in the Faculty of Education, and theÌýKahnawà:ke Education CentreÌý(KEC). It’s also in line with McGill’sÌýTask Force on Indigenous Studies and Indigenous Education.
